基于Windows98的三坐标CNC系统的研究

基于Windows98的三坐标CNC系统的研究

ID:36619070

大小:1.87 MB

页数:58页

时间:2019-05-13

基于Windows98的三坐标CNC系统的研究_第1页
基于Windows98的三坐标CNC系统的研究_第2页
基于Windows98的三坐标CNC系统的研究_第3页
基于Windows98的三坐标CNC系统的研究_第4页
基于Windows98的三坐标CNC系统的研究_第5页
资源描述:

《基于Windows98的三坐标CNC系统的研究》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、山东理工大学硕士学位论文基于Windows98的三坐标CNC系统的研究姓名:赵国勇申请学位级别:硕士专业:机械电子工程指导教师:赵玉刚2003.5.1山东理工大学硕士学位论文一一摘要弋嗉缸\’l,开放式结构的计算机数控系统具有灵活的软硬件结构,可以方便的进行软硬件的更新换代,是适应FMS、CIMS环境的机床控制器的理想结构。基于Windows的开放式CNC系统是现在的一个研究热点。少r论文对CNC的发展现状、发展趋势进行了介绍,并阐述了数字化仿形加工技术的发展。本文研究的重点是:以开放式CNC体系为指导思想,在Windows98下开发适合于数字化仿形特点的三坐标CNC系统。

2、本论文设计了CNC接口电路。使用该接口电路可以对48点数字量进行I/O操作,可以进行精确定时,并触发PC总线的中断IRQ3或IRQ5或IRQ7。将变压器、PC机、步进电机驱动器等器件封装到一个控制柜里,使更加紧凑、安全、美观。并设计了主轴电机和冷却泵电动机的控制电路。本论文以开放式CNC体系为指导思想,以Windows98为开发平台,以Delphi、VC、VTOOLSD为开发语言,开发了一套三坐标CNC系统软件i在Windows98下开发CNC系统的一个难点在于如何实现实时中断,因为Windows98系统不允许Win32程序直接操作底层硬件。本论文在分析研究岳采用了VXD技

3、术进行Windows98下的实时中断操作,从而解决了用Windows98开发CNC系统的实时控制问题。《该CNC软件可实现以下功能:三坐标联动、加工程序编辑选择功能、手动、点动、模拟运行、自动运行、加工轨迹显示、坐标翻转显示,以及步进电机加减速控制等。该软件图形用户界面友好,操作方便,实现了三坐标CNC系统的绝大部分功能。本论文对开放式CNC系统的研究具有一定参考价值。乃’关键词:CNC,数字化仿形加工,接口电路,实时中断,VXDAbstractHavingflexiblehardwareandsoftware,theCNCsystemofopenArchitecturei

4、SconvenienttoberenewedandthereforesuitableforFMFandCIMScircumstance.TheCNCsystemofopenArchitecturebasedonwindowsplatformhasbeenaresearchcenterrecently.ThedevelopmentrealityandtendencyofCNCiSintroduced:andthedevelopmentofDigitizing&Copyingmanufacturingtechnologyisexpoundedinthethesis.Theres

5、earchemphasisofthisthesisistodevelopthreecoordinatesCNCsystemfitforDigitizing&Copyingmanufacturing,guidedbytheCNCsystemofopenArchitecturebasedonthewindows98platform.TheCNCCOnjunctioncircuitisdevisedinthethesis.Usingthecircuit,wecanoperate48I/O,controlpreciselywiththeinterruptionofPCBUS.Tra

6、nsformer、PCcomputer、SteppingMotordrivingdeviceandSOonaremountedintoacontrolcabinet,whichmakesmuchmorecompactandtransfigure.Thecontrolcircuitformainaxismotorandcoolingpumpmotorisexcogitated.AsetofsoftwareofthreecoordinatesCNCsystemguidedbytheCNCsystemofopenArchitecturebasedonwindows98isdevi

7、sedwiththedevelopmentlanguageDelphi、VCandVTOOLSDinthisthesis.ThedifficultyofdevelopingCNCsystembasedonwindows98ishowtoachieverealtimeinterruptionbecausewindows98doesnotallowwin32procedurestomanipulatebasementhardwaresdirectly.SoVXDtechnologyisadoptedtooperatet

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。